**Ticket #—Fire-drill roll call, Brackwell Annex**

Hi team assistants — quick one. During Thursday's drill, roll call happens at the muster point by the Fenleigh courtyard. Grab your floor's clipboard from the warden cabinet before heading down, and tick people off as they arrive. The cabinet sits behind the third-floor kitchenette and stays locked outside drills. To open it, punch in the warden cabinet code below.

door code, yagap-bahof: bdg-O-05

Handover note — Crumbwheel order cutoffs.

Welcome aboard. The bakery cutoff rule in Crumbwheel closes same-day orders at 14:00 local to each storefront, not UTC — this has bitten us twice. Holiday overrides live in the calendar service and take precedence silently, so always check there first when a cutoff looks wrong. To unlock the calendar service's admin console after a restart, enter the recovery passphrase below.

vault phrase of bagap-bahaf = silion-pelox-sorox-casdor-quenwyn-fraax-eliox-praael-kelion-quenvan-kasox-rusael-norius-belvan

Subject: Cut-over complete — user module extraction

Hi Ines,

The user module is now fully extracted from the Cobblewright monolith and serving all authentication traffic as the standalone Keyline service. Dual-write mode ran cleanly for six days before we flipped reads. Rollback path remains available for two weeks. The settings Keyline launched with are listed below.

settings of bafof-fajog:
[aldix]
port = 9300
region = north-3
host = aldix.kelvilabs.example
team = istath
timeout_ms = 1500
retries = 8